About The Position

As our Foundation Development Associate, you will be responsible for maximizing philanthropic opportunities by engaging with major philanthropists. Your strong knowledge of development-based fundraising will be used to reach out and meet with prospects and investors in the local community. You will manage a portfolio of prospects and donors generating fundraising results from your conversations. Every day, you will serve as a crucial liaison to numerous entities (i.e., hospitals, hospice, research institutes), identifying key stakeholders, building essential relationships, and fostering a robust two-way flow of information. This ensures alignment of objectives and maximizes collaborative opportunities that advance our mission. To be successful in this role, you must have strong knowledge of philanthropic concepts, modern fundraising principles and a strong understanding of the art and science of related relationship building. In addition, you must be able to demonstrate strong organization/communication skills as well as self-motivation and perseverance in achieving established goals.

Responsibilities

  • Develop, manage and implement the employee and annual giving campaigns.
  • Works closely with manager in development and preparation of solicitation strategies; makes recommendations for long range and annual development plans to reach stated goals.
  • Oversees all annual giving initiatives, including direct mail campaigns to enhance donor acquisition, annual employee’s campaigns, and donor recognition wall.
  • Recommends solicitation method, plans, and implements, evaluates and reports on activities.
  • Participates in major gift campaigns as required.
  • Coordinates special events, SCRUBS and other similar fundraising events identified by the Foundation.
  • Responsible for communications for the Foundation, including updating website presence, social media content, newsletter creations, one page summaries etc.
  • Provides administrative support for campus events, including processing payments for sponsorships, tickets sales, entering payments into RE, preparing acknowledgement letters etc.
